Counterpoint - play Morrowind if you want to play a different Elder Scrolls. Daggerfall with all it's scope sounds good on paper, but it's actually perhaps more shallow than Skyrim despite it's reputation. The world may be 1000x the size, but you trudge through pointless wilderness and find nothing or walk around clusters of hundreds of identical buildings in the 100s of identical towns. You're basically expected to fast travel everywhere (again, a criticism often levied at Skytim) and in the few cases you can't finding the entrance to whatever place they want you to go is such a pain in the ass when it's some stupid entrance in the middle of a landmarkless wasteland. The places you go to are just messes of 3D maze pieces that are not fun to navigate outside of the few hand-crafted ones for main story stuff.

All of Daggerfall's mechanical depth is wasted on it's lack of meaningful content to use with it. I was surprised to learn all this when playing it expecting it to be the best in the series, but it's true. Morrowind is the best balance we have between older TES mechanical depth and newer TES world design.
